6. How much heat is lost cooling 25 grams of water from 90°C to 45°C?

Answer:

4,7025 (kJ).

Step-by-step explanation:

1) according to the condition: m=25 gr.; t₂=90; t₁=45; c=4.18 J/(g°C);

2) the formula of required heat is

Q=c*m*(t₂- t₁);

3) according to the formula of heat:

Q=4.18*25*45=4702.5 (J).
